Labor Lemonade

This hydrating elixir features my Expecting Tea, a mineral rich and uterine toning herbal blend as its base, but can easily be replaced with water if there isn't enough time to brew tea. Birth, being the marathon that it is, requires deep hydration and healthy sugars to keep energy up. This recipe has a very neutral flavor that also curbs nausea, perfect for a laboring mama. Also, never underestimate the power of Rescue Remedy, a homeopathic that may help with anxiety, stress, and trauma.

Ingredients:

12 cups Expecting Tea, steeped

Juice of 4 Lemons

7 drops of Rescue Remedy

1/2 cup of Raw, Unpasteurized Honey

1mL Concentrace Liquid Trace Minerals

Instructions:

To make your  Expecting tea, steep 1/2 cup of Expecting Tea to 12 cups of hot water for at least 1 hour). After steeping, strain into a pot. Add Honey, Rescue Remedy and Concentrace. Bottle into mason jars and serve chilled- or prepare before labor day and freeze into mason jars.
